According to the Air Quality Index (AQI) data from the Environmental Protection Agency (EPA), multiple US cities, including New York, Chicago, and Dallas, are experiencing AQI levels classified as ‘Unhealthy for Sensitive Groups’ or worse. The wildfires in Canada, which have been burning for several weeks, have produced large quantities of smoke and particulate matter that have traveled southward, affecting air quality across the border.
Canadian officials have reported that over 200 wildfires are currently active, with some classified as out of control. The smoke plumes have been tracked by satellite imagery and air quality monitoring systems, showing extensive coverage over eastern and central parts of the US. The EPA has issued health advisories urging residents, especially children, the elderly, and those with pre-existing health conditions, to limit outdoor activities and use portable air conditioners to reduce indoor pollution.
While the exact composition of the smoke and its long-term health impacts are still being studied, preliminary assessments indicate elevated levels of fine particulate matter (PM2.5), which can penetrate deep into the lungs and bloodstream. Recent Trends in Wildfire Activity and Air Quality Impact
Over the past decade, the frequency and scale of wildfires in Canada and the US have increased significantly, driven by rising temperatures, drought conditions, and forest management challenges. The 2026 wildfire season in Canada has been particularly severe, with over 2,000 square miles burned so far. These fires have produced vast amounts of smoke that can travel thousands of miles, affecting air quality across North America. Previous incidents, such as the 2023 wildfires in the US West, also demonstrated the health and economic impacts of wildfire smoke, prompting calls for stronger mitigation strategies.
Scientists warn that climate change is likely to exacerbate these trends, leading to more frequent and intense wildfire events, which in turn will have ongoing effects on regional air quality and public health systems.

Key Questions
How does wildfire smoke affect health?
Wildfire smoke contains fine particulate matter (PM2.5) that can penetrate deep into the lungs and bloodstream, causing respiratory issues, aggravating asthma, and increasing cardiovascular risks, especially for vulnerable populations.
Which areas are most affected right now?
Major cities including New York, Chicago, Dallas, and others in the eastern and central US are experiencing elevated AQI levels due to Canadian wildfire smoke.
What can residents do to protect themselves?
Residents should stay indoors during high pollution periods, use air purifiers if available, limit outdoor activities, and follow local health advisories.
